Chief Minister of Punjab Maryam Nawaz Sharif launched the Apni Chhat Apna Ghar Program — a housing scheme that gives a loan to low-income families to build their own home. This program is very useful because it is without interest. You can build your own home without going to an expensive bank, and without feeling helpless.

This program is currently active across all 36 districts of Punjab. If you own a small piece of land and cannot afford to build on it, this guide is for you.

This article explains what the program is, qualification criteria, required documents, and how to apply step by step.

Quick Overview of Apni Chhat Apna Ghar Program

Apni Chhat Apna Ghar is a special initiative of the Chief Minister of Punjab just like BISP 8171. The scheme aims to provide 100,000 affordable houses and apartments to eligible residents in all areas of the province. It is useful for low-income households who are currently living in rented buildings.

The program was launched in August 2024. It provides interest-free loans of up to Rs. 1.5 million (15 lac rupees) to eligible families across all 36 districts of Punjab. The government covers 60% of the loan amount.

The executive agency of this program is Punjab Housing and Town Planning Agency (PHATA). The administrative department of this program is Housing, Urban Development and Public Health Engineering Department (HUD&PHED).

Eligibility Criteria – Who Can Apply?

Like other government programs, for example BISP, this is also a conditional loan program. You must meet the eligibility criteria to get the loan.

You Must Be the Head of Your Family

According to NADRA records, the applicant must be the head of their family. In NADRA records, if you are not the head of family then update your records at NADRA first before applying.

You Must Be a Permanent Resident of Punjab

The applicant must be a permanent resident of Punjab, according to his NADRA CNIC. Your CNIC address must be within the Punjab Province. If you live in Punjab and your NADRA address is outside of Punjab then update the records at NADRA.

You Must Own a Small Plot of Land

The applicant must be the sole owner and possessor of residential plot land. The land must be 5 Marla or less in urban areas, and up to 10 Marla in rural areas anywhere in Punjab. Shared ownership creates complications, therefore the land must be registered in your name only.

You Must Be Registered in NSER with a PMT Score of 60 or Below

The applicant must be registered with the National Socio-Economic Registry (NSER) in a household having a PMT score of 60 or less. If you are not registered in NSER, visit your nearest BISP Tehsil Office and get registered before applying. Your PMT score reflects your poverty level. The lower the score, the more deserving you are and you will have higher chances of getting the loan.

You Must Have No Criminal Record

The applicant should not have a criminal record such as being convicted for anti-state, anti-social activities, or any heinous crimes. If a false FIR is entered in a police station against your name, you can visit the nearest police station and get it removed.

You Must Not Be a Loan Defaulter

The applicant should not be a loan defaulter of any financial institution or bank. If you have an old unpaid loan at any bank, settle it before applying.

You Must Not Already Own a Constructed House

The applicant should not already own a constructed house in his name. The scheme is for families who genuinely do not have a home, not those who are looking to expand existing property.

Who Cannot Apply?

You cannot apply if:

  • Your CNIC address is from a province other than Punjab.
  • You own more land than the limit (more than 5 Marla urban / 10 Marla rural).
  • Your PMT score is above 60.
  • You are a loan defaulter at any bank of Pakistan.
  • You already own a built house anywhere in Pakistan.
  • You have a criminal record of any kind.

Required Documents

Gather all of these documents before you start your application. Missing any one document can delay or reject your application.

Personal Documents

  • Original CNIC – front and back copy. Make sure it is not expired.
  • 2 to 4 recent passport size photographs with blue or white background.

Land Ownership Documents

  • Registry, Fard, or Allotment Letter – verified by PLRA (Punjab Land Records Authority).
  • Possession Document – proof that you physically possess the plot, not just the file.

Financial Documents

  • Salary slip or bank statement for the last 6 months. If you are a daily wage worker or self-employed, an affidavit about your income is accepted.

Additional Documents

  • Latest electricity or gas bill (for address verification).
  • Affidavit stating that you do not own any other property. The template is available on the official ACAG portal. You do not need to write it yourself.
  • Children’s B-Forms.

Make sure your NADRA records are updated before you apply. If your CNIC address, family head status, or other details are not correct in NADRA’s system, your application will be rejected immediately. Please update your NADRA file before applying.

How to Apply – Step-by-Step Process

You can apply for the Apni Chhat Apna Ghar Program using three methods: the ACAG Portal, the helpline, or in person.

Apply Online via ACAG Portal

You can apply online through Apni Chhat Apna Ghar portal. Here is step by step guide for the application of this program.

1

Visit the Portal

Open your phone or computer browser. Go to acag.punjab.gov.pk — this is the only official website. Do not apply on any other website. There are fake websites that steal your information.

2

Account Creation

Click the “Registration” button at the top right corner of the homepage. You will be taken to a registration form. Enter your CNIC number, mobile number, and email address. Create a password and verify your account.

3

Details and Information

After creating your account, log in and fill in your complete information. This includes your family details, NSER registration number, land details, and income information. Fill everything accurately because wrong information causes immediate disqualification.

4

Upload Documents

Upload scanned copies or clear photos of all required documents. Make sure photos are clear and human-readable. Blurry documents are not accepted and can cause delay or rejection for this program.

5

Review and Submission

Review all the information once before submitting. After submission, you will receive a confirmation SMS on your registered mobile number.

6

Verification Process

After submission, your application goes through multiple verification stages before approval. NADRA verifies your identity and family status. PLRA verifies your land ownership. A field government officer visits your land to confirm possession.

7

Selection

After the balloting process, the government releases the names of successful applicants. If your status says “Approved,” you are on the list. The Punjab Government also uploads district-wise lists on the official Information Department website, and beneficiaries may receive an official SMS informing them of selection.

Apply by Phone

If you do not have a smartphone or a stable internet connection, you can apply using your simple phone. You can register by calling the toll-free helpline: 0800-09100. By calling this number, you can obtain complete information about the scheme and apply for registration. A representative will collect the required details from you and complete the registration process on your behalf.

This is a completely free call. You do not pay anything. The representative will ask you questions about your eligibility and guide you through each step.

Apply in Person at a Registration Center

If you are unable to apply online or through the helpline, you may visit the nearest registration center in your city. You will need to provide the required documents and personal details. A government representative will assist you and complete the application form for you.

Bring all original documents when you visit. The government representative does not charge any fee. If anyone asks you for money, refuse and report them.

Loan Details and Payment Plan

This is a government subsidy scheme and you do not have to pay all of the amount back. Here are the details:

Total Loan Amount

The maximum loan under this program is Rs. 1,500,000 (Rs. 15 Lakh). You can also request a lower amount depending on your construction needs. Smaller loans mean smaller installments.

Government Subsidy

If you are selected as a beneficiary, you only need to pay 40% of the total house cost. The government will cover the remaining 60% of the housing cost in the form of a subsidy.

For example, if you get a Rs. 15 lakh loan, the government covers Rs. 9 lakhs. You only repay Rs. 6 lakhs. And that too with zero interest.

Grace Period

The first 3 months after receiving the loan are payment-free. This is called the grace period. This allows families to focus on construction without worrying about repayments immediately.

Monthly Installments

The monthly installment is approximately Rs. 26,000. The repayment period is 5 to 7 years. Some models offer installments as low as Rs. 14,000, depending on the loan amount and tenure chosen.

What if You Miss an Installment?

The Punjab Government understands the financial realities of low-income families, so the policy is supportive rather than harsh. If a family misses installments due to financial difficulty, grace time is normally allowed. However, continuous failure to repay may result in consequences to maintain transparency and discipline in the program.

The government’s approach in this loan scheme is different from banks. It is to help, not to punish. But do not take this as a reason to avoid repayments. Pay regularly because your home depends on it.

Three Execution Models of the Program

Apni Chhat Apna Ghar Program does not work the same way for everyone. It has three models depending on your situation.

Government Land with Developer Partnership Model

In this model, Punjab Housing and Town Planning Agency collaborates with private developers to construct homes. They construct the homes on state land through a land equity arrangement. Private developers will construct approximately 10,000 houses under this model. Developers are responsible for constructing infrastructure, including amenities, utilities, and roads, while following the guidelines of PHATA in terms of design. After construction is complete, the government determines the price of the apartment and provides a suitable installment plan.

This model is mainly for people who do not own land. The government provides the land and developers build the houses.

Private Housing Scheme Partnership Model

This model is designed for medium-sized districts and works within private housing schemes under the Affordable Private Housing Scheme (APHS) Rules 2020. The government collaborates with private housing societies to make affordable homes for eligible families.

Interest-Free Loan for Your Own Land

This is the model most families use and it is the most popular model. This model offers direct interest-free loans to individuals who already own land. It gives them full control over construction according to their needs and budget.

If you own land and need money to build on it, this is the model for you.

Common Problems and Their Solutions

Many applicants face issues during the application process. Here are the most common ones and exactly what to do.

Problem 1 – Application Rejected

Why this happens:

  • Your CNIC is expired.
  • You are not registered as the head of family in NADRA.
  • PMT score is above 60.
  • Land ownership documents are incomplete.
  • Criminal record or loan default found.

Solution: First, find out the exact reason for rejection from the ACAG portal or helpline. Fix the specific issue, whether it is a NADRA update, NSER registration, or document correction. Then re-apply when the next registration window opens.

Problem 2 – Application Status Not Updating

Why this happens:

  • Verification is still in progress.
  • Field visit is pending.
  • PLRA check on your land is taking time.

Solution: Log in to your account at acag.punjab.gov.pk and check your status. Do not call repeatedly or visit offices unnecessarily. Updates are also sent via SMS or email when your application status changes. If there is no update after 30 days, call 0800-09100.

Problem 3 – Biometric or NADRA Verification Issues

Why this happens:

  • Your CNIC information does not match NADRA records.
  • You are not listed as the family head in NADRA’s system.
  • Your address on CNIC does not match Punjab.

Solution: Visit your nearest NADRA office. Get your CNIC updated. Correct your family head status. This must be done before re-applying. NADRA updates usually take 2 to 7 working days to reflect in the system.

Problem 5 – You Cannot Apply Online

Solution: Call 0800-09100. This is a free number. A government representative will register you over the phone. You can also visit a nearby PHATA facilitation center. Bring your original documents.

Problem 4 – Someone Is Asking for Money to Help You Apply

This is fraud. The registration process is completely free. Do not pay anyone for assistance. No genuine government representative will ask for money. If someone demands payment, refuse, do not give your CNIC details, and report them to the BISP helpline or 0800-09100 immediately.

Latest Updates for 2026

Joint Family Expansion Loans Now Allowed

As of January 2026, joint families living in one house can now apply for loans to add floors or rooms to existing structures. This is a major update for extended families who need more space but cannot afford construction.

64,000+ Loans Already Issued

Since its launch, the scheme has shown strong progress and financial discipline, with 64,000 or more interest-free loans already issued in the initial phase.

99.9% Recovery Rate

The 99.9% recovery rate demonstrates that loan allocation is reaching responsible, committed households. This number shows that beneficiaries are making their repayments, which is keeping the program financially healthy for future beneficiaries.

Expansion Across Punjab

The scheme currently covers major cities including Lahore, Rawalpindi, Faisalabad, Sialkot, Multan, and Sargodha, and is expanding to 30 or more districts including Jhelum, Kasur, Khanewal, and others.
